    The excess energy of the DC link is dissipated via the braking resistor.

    The braking resistor is connected to a Braking Module. The braking resistor is positioned outside the cabinet or switchgear room. This arrangement enables the resulting heat losses to be dissipated, thereby allowing a corresponding reduction in the level of air conditioning required.

    2 braking resistors with different rated and peak power values are available for chassis format units.

    The braking resistor is monitored on the basis of the mark-space ratio. A temperature switch (NC contact) is also fitted. This responds when the maximum permissible temperature is exceeded and can be evaluated by a controller.
